Electric sand-lime stirrer
The electric sand and lime mixer, driven by a rotating cutter wheel assembly, a mixing assembly, and a bidirectional motor, solves the problems of mobility and power supply of traditional mixers, achieving efficient and flexible sand and lime mixing and meeting the requirements for high uniformity.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of mixing equipment technology, and in particular to an electric sand and ash mixer. Background Technology
[0002] In construction engineering and sand and lime production operations, sand and lime mixing is a common and crucial task. Traditional sand and lime mixing methods often rely on large, stationary mixers. These mixers are bulky, heavy, and have relatively fixed installation and usage locations, making them difficult to move flexibly between different sites, especially in scenarios with limited space or requiring frequent changes in work location, which is extremely inconvenient. Furthermore, traditional stationary mixers usually require an external power supply, and the length of the power cord limits their working range, making them unusable in areas without power outlets or with unstable power supplies. In addition, the mixing structure of traditional mixers is relatively simple, and the mixing effect may not be ideal, failing to meet the requirements of some operations that demand high uniformity of sand and lime mixing. Based on these problems, the development of a freely movable, high-performance, and easily powered electric sand and lime mixer has become an urgent need in the industry. Utility Model Content
[0003] The purpose of this invention is to provide an electric sand and ash mixer to solve at least one of the problems mentioned in the background art.
[0004]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ution: an electric sand and ash mixer, comprising two rotating blade groups, each of the two rotating blade groups comprising a support ring, a connecting ring, four connecting plates, and four stirring blades. The connecting ring is located at the center of the inner side of the support ring, and the four connecting plates and four stirring blades are staggered and distributed on the inner side of the support ring. One end of each of the four connecting plates and four stirring blades is fixedly connected to the support ring, and the other end of each of the four connecting plates and four stirring blades is fixedly connected to the connecting ring.
[0005] Preferably, four stirring groups are provided between the two rotating blade groups. Each of the four stirring groups includes a connecting block and four arc-shaped blades. The four arc-shaped blades are evenly distributed on the connecting block and are threadedly connected to the connecting block.
[0006] Preferably, a bidirectional motor is provided between the four stirring groups.
[0007] Preferably, both output ends of the bidirectional motor are detachably connected to one end of a connecting rod;
[0008] The two rotating blade assembly and the four stirring assembly are respectively mounted on the two connecting rods, and the two connecting rings and the four connecting blocks are detachably connected to the two connecting rods.
[0009] Preferably, the electric sand and ash mixer further includes a bearing shell, and the other ends of the two connecting rods are rotatably connected to the inner side of the bearing shell.
[0010] Preferably, a battery box is detachably connected to the top of the support shell, and the battery box is electrically connected to the bidirectional motor.
[0011] Preferably, a handrail is provided at the rear end of the battery box, and the bottom of the handrail is detachably connected to the supporting shell.
[0012] The beneficial effects of this utility model are as follows:
[0013] The unique design of the rotating cutter wheel assembly in this invention is as follows: The rotating cutter wheel assembly consists of a support ring, a connecting ring, a connecting plate, and a stirring blade. During operation, the support ring provides both support and ensures stable movement of the device. The connecting ring can be connected to a connecting rod, allowing the rotating cutter wheel assembly to rotate. The connecting plate and the stirring blade work together to connect the support ring and the connecting ring, forming a stable rotating cutter wheel assembly structure. The stirring blades, while supporting the movement of the support ring, simultaneously stir the sand and ash, achieving a combination of stable movement and stirring, greatly facilitating the user.
[0014] The mixing function of the mixing group: Four mixing groups are set between the two rotating cutter wheel groups. Their arc-shaped blades are evenly distributed on the connecting block and are threaded together. During the movement of the device, the mixing groups rotate accordingly. The arc-shaped blades can effectively mix the sand and ash, further enhancing the mixing effect and improving the uniformity of the sand and ash mixture.
[0015] The driving function of the bidirectional motor: The bidirectional motor can drive the two connecting rods to rotate, thereby driving the rotating cutter wheel assembly and the stirring assembly to operate. It is the core power for the operation of the entire device, enabling the device to efficiently complete the sand and ash mixing task and providing users with a convenient operating experience.
[0016] The convenience of detachable connection: The bidirectional motor output end, the connecting rod, the connecting ring of the rotating cutter wheel assembly, and the connecting block of the mixing assembly are all detachable, which facilitates the installation, maintenance and replacement of parts of the device, and reduces the cost of use and maintenance difficulty;
[0017] Multifunctionality of the bearing shell: The bearing shell supports the internal components and can also prevent dust from being blown out during the operation of the device;
[0018] Advantages of battery box power supply: The battery box provides power to the bidirectional motor, freeing it from the constraints of wires and external power supply, making the device's movement unrestricted, allowing it to operate freely in a wider range of locations, and greatly improving the device's flexibility and practicality.
[0019] Convenient operation with the handrail: The handrail at the rear of the battery box is convenient for users to hold and operate, making it easy to move the device and allowing users to easily control the device's position and direction. Attached Figure Description

[0027] This utility model provides, for example Figure 1-4 The sand and lime electric mixer shown includes two rotating cutter wheel assemblies 4. Each rotating cutter wheel assembly 4 includes a support ring 41, a connecting ring 44, four connecting pieces 42, and four mixing blades 43. The connecting ring 44 is located at the center of the inner side of the support ring 41. The four connecting pieces 42 and the four mixing blades 43 are staggered inside the support ring 41. One end of each of the four connecting pieces 42 and the four mixing blades 43 is fixedly connected to the support ring 41, and the other end of each of the four connecting pieces 42 and the four mixing blades 43 is fixedly connected to the connecting ring 44.
[0028] The rotating cutter wheel assembly 4 is formed by combining the support ring 41, connecting ring 44, connecting piece 42, and stirring blade 43. The support ring 41 provides support and ensures stable movement of the device during operation. The connecting ring 44 connects the rotating cutter wheel assembly 4 to the connecting rod 7, enabling rotation. The connecting piece 42 and stirring blade 43 connect the support ring 41 and the connecting ring 44, thus assembling the rotating cutter wheel assembly 4. The stirring blade 43 simultaneously supports the device's movement via the support ring 41 and stirs the sand and ash. In summary, the rotating cutter wheel assembly 4 provides both stable movement and stirring capabilities, offering convenience to the user.
[0029] Four stirring groups 5 are arranged between the two rotating blade groups 4. Each of the four stirring groups 5 includes a connecting block 52 and four arc-shaped blades 51. The four arc-shaped blades 51 are evenly distributed on the connecting block 52 and are threadedly connected to the connecting block 52.
[0030] During the movement of this device, the stirring group 5 can rotate along with the movement of the device, and the arc-shaped blade 51 can thus stir the sand and ash.
[0031] A bidirectional motor 6 is installed between the four mixing groups 5.
[0032] With the assistance of the bidirectional motor 6, the two connecting rods 7 can be driven to rotate, and the connecting rods 7 drive the part above them to rotate, thus realizing the operation of the device and bringing convenience to the user.
[0033] Both output ends of the bidirectional motor 6 are detachably connected to one end of the connecting rod 7;
[0034] Two rotating blade wheel groups 4 and four stirring groups 5 are respectively set on two connecting rods 7, and two connecting rings 44 and four connecting blocks 52 are detachably connected to the two connecting rods 7.
[0035] The sand and ash electric mixer also includes a bearing shell 3, and the other ends of the two connecting rods 7 are rotatably connected to the inside of the bearing shell 3.
[0036] The supporting shell 3 supports the parts inside it and also achieves the effect of dust blocking during the operation of this device, bringing convenience to the user.
[0037] The top of the carrier shell 3 is detachably connected to the battery box 2, which is electrically connected to the bidirectional motor 6.
[0038] The battery box 2 is the part that supplies power to the bidirectional motor 6. Its power supply method and effect are common knowledge. With the setting of the battery box 2, the bidirectional motor 6 no longer relies on wires to connect to the power source, and the movement of the device is no longer restricted, which brings convenience to the user.
[0039] A handle 1 is provided at the rear of the battery box 2, and the bottom of the handle 1 is detachably connected to the bearing shell 3.
[0040] The user can easily move the device by holding the handle 1.
